The typical American commute has been getting longer each year since 2010. The average one-way commute in Chase Crossing takes 22.0 minutes. That's shorter than the US average of 26.4 minutes.

How people in Chase Crossing get to work:
- 94.9% drive their own car alone
- 5.1% carpool with others
- 0.0% work from home
- 0.0% take mass transit
